1.7 Corrosion
Corrosion can also affect bowl parts made of stainless steel. This corrosion can
be flat-spread or pit- or crack-shaped and merits special attention.
Corrosion on stainless steel bowl material should be examined thoroughly and
documented.
Flat-spread corrosion can usually be measured (reduction of wall thickness)
Pit- or crack-shaped corrosion cannot be measured without the risk of damage.
At the initial stage pit-shaped corrosion is generally caused by chlorine ions.
Depending on the stressing of the part, pit-shaped corrosion can result in crack-
shaped corrosion.
Fig. 43
Possible formation of pit-shaped cor-
rosion.
Such pittings can only be investigated by a materials expert.
In case of crack-shaped corrosion attack with or without superposed flat-spread
and pit-shaped corrosion on main bowl components,
the machine must be
shut down immediately
.
Contact your nearest Westfalia Separator representative for a thorough exami-
nation.
Fig. 44
Pittings
Pittings which are close together or
form a linear pattern can signify crack
formation beneath the surface.
Such pittings should be investigated
by a materials expert.
